How many chairs fit around a dining table?

The number of chairs that fit around a dining table depends on various factors, including the table's shape, size, and the desired seating arrangement. As a general rule, rectangular tables can accommodate one chair on each shorter side and one chair for every 2 feet of the longer sides. For round tables, a good estimate is to allow for one chair per foot of the table's diameter.

What size rug fits under a modern dining table? 

As a general guideline, dining room rugs should extend at least 24-30 inches beyond all sides of the dining table. This ensures that chairs remain on the rug even when pulled out for seating. For round tables, opt for a round rug that allows for ample coverage around the entire table.

 

How much space do you need around a dining table? 

As a general rule, aim for a clearance of at least 36 inches (91 cm) between the edge of the table and the surrounding furniture or walls. This allows sufficient room for guests to move around and pull out chairs with ease. However, for a more spacious and luxurious feel, consider increasing the clearance to 48 inches (122 cm) or more. 

 

How to clean wood dining tables 

Dust your wood dining table regularly with a soft, lint-free cloth or microfiber duster to remove loose debris.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or rough materials that can scratch the surface. For spills or stains, immediately blot the area with a damp cloth and mild soap, then dry it thoroughly. To maintain the wood dining table's natural luster, periodically apply a high-quality furniture polish or wax.
